Golden Cariboo Resources Ltd
Golden Cariboo Resources Ltd., an exploration stage junior mining company, engages in the identification, acquisition, and exploration of mineral properties in Canada. It primarily explores for gold and silver deposits. The Its principal properties includes interest in Quesnelle Gold Quartz Mine Property located in central British Columbia, Canada. Golden Cariboo Resources Ltd (GCCFF) - Total Liabilities
Latest total liabilities as of September 2025: $478.56K USD
Based on the latest financial reports, Golden Cariboo Resources Ltd (GCCFF) has total liabilities worth $478.56K USD as of September 2025.
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Annual Total Liabilities for Golden Cariboo Resources Ltd (2014–2025)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Golden Cariboo Resources Ltd from 2014 to 2025.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-09-30 | $478.56K | +94.16% |
| 2024-09-30 | $246.48K | -56.82% |
| 2023-09-30 | $570.83K | +79.12% |
| 2022-09-30 | $318.68K | +194.13% |
| 2021-09-30 | $108.35K | +66.37% |
| 2020-09-30 | $65.12K | +65.74% |
| 2019-09-30 | $39.29K | -61.89% |
| 2018-09-30 | $103.09K | -78.49% |
| 2017-09-30 | $479.31K | +1.17% |
| 2016-09-30 | $473.77K | -1.31% |
| 2015-09-30 | $480.06K | -20.72% |
| 2014-09-30 | $605.52K | -- |
